More about finance broker courses in Northern Territory

If you're looking to advance your career in the financial sector, there are several excellent Finance Broker courses in Northern Territory designed for experienced learners. These courses cater to individuals who already possess prior qualifications or experience in finance. Among the most sought-after options are the Certificate IV in Finance and Mortgage Broking FNS40821, ideal for those looking to deepen their expertise in mortgage broking, and the advanced Diploma of Finance and Mortgage Broking Management FNS50322, which focuses on management skills in the finance sector.

For individuals seeking higher education qualifications, the Graduate Certificate in Finance and the comprehensive Master of Finance are excellent choices. Furthermore, the Bachelor of Commerce (Finance) and Bachelor of Business (Finance) offer robust frameworks for building a solid foundation in finance and business principals.
